define(['underscore', 'resolver/assets', 'node-dir', 'path', 'fs'],
function (_, utils, dir, path, fs) {
'use strict';
return _.extend({
_cache: {
},
// resolve component path for listing assets directory contents
_resolvePath: function (component) {
var pathParts = component === 'app' ? ['app'] : ['components'];
if (component !== 'app') {
pathParts.push(component);
}
pathParts.push('assets');
return path.resolve(LAZO.FILE_REPO_PATH + path.sep + path.join.apply(this, pathParts));
},
_getLocaleFromPath: function (assetPath) {
var pathParts = assetPath.split(path.sep);
return pathParts.length > 1 ? pathParts[0] : 'defaults';
},
// transform windows path for web url
_transformPath: function (path) {
return path.replace(/\\/g, '/');
},
// strip ABSOLUTE_PATH/assets from path
_getRelativePaths: function (files, component) {
var self = this;
return files.map(function (file) {
return file.replace(path.normalize(self._resolvePath(component) + path.sep), '');
});
},
// iterate over component map and resolve assets
_resolveComponentsAssets: function (map, ctx) {
for (var k in map) {
map[k] = this.resolveAssets(map[k], ctx);
}
return map;
},
get: function (components, ctx, options) {
var loaded = 0;
var assets = {};
var self = this;
function onDone(assets, ctx) {
assets = self._resolveComponentsAssets(assets, ctx);
_.extend(self._cache, assets);
return assets;
}
for (var i = 0; i < components.length; i++) {
assets[components[i]] = {};
if (this._cache[components[i]]) {
assets[components[i]] = this._cache[components[i]];
loaded++;
if (loaded === components.length) {
return options.success(assets);
}
continue;
}
(function (i) {
var cmpPath = self._resolvePath(components[i]);
fs.exists(cmpPath, function (exists) {
if (exists) {
dir.files(cmpPath, function (err, files) {
loaded++;
if (err) {
LAZO.logger.warn('[assets.get] error reading component directory.', err);
} else {
var j = files.length;
// remove 'assets[path.sep]'
files = self._getRelativePaths(files, components[i]);
while (j--) {
var locale = self._getLocaleFromPath(files[j]);
if (_.isUndefined(assets[components[i]][locale])) {
assets[components[i]][locale] = {};
}
if (/strings\.json$/.test(files[j])) { // read assets property file
loaded--;
(function (locale, cmpPath) {
fs.readFile(path.resolve(cmpPath + path.sep + files[j]), function (err, strings) {
loaded++;
if (err) {
LAZO.logger.warn('[assets.get] error reading component property file.', err);
} else {
try {
strings = JSON.parse(strings);
_.extend(assets[components[i]][locale], strings);
} catch (e) {
LAZO.logger.warn('[assets.get] error parsing component property file.', e);
}
}
if (loaded === components.length) {
options.success(onDone(assets, ctx));
}
});
})(locale, cmpPath);
} else { // add assets file
files[j] = self._transformPath(files[j]);
assets[components[i]][locale][self.resolveAssetKey(files[j])] = self.resolveAssetPath(files[j], components[i], ctx);
}
}
}
if (loaded === components.length) {
options.success(onDone(assets, ctx));
}
});
} else {
loaded++;
if (loaded === components.length) {
options.success(onDone(assets, ctx));
}
}
});
})(i);
}
}
}, utils);
});
